The Allosaurus was one of the largest and most ferocious predators of the late Jurassic period (140-155 million years ago). Predating the T-Rex by about 60 million years, its 33" jaw was lined with about 40-50 serrated 2-4" teeth, making the Allosaurus the consummate carnosaur. We offer a perfect reproduction made from molds of the actual Allosaurus fragilis discovered at the Morrison Formation in Colorado. Every detail is preserved including sinus cavities, strong ridges above the eye sockets and vicious dental structure.
